### Escalation Path — AgriLink Gateway

If the Harrowfield telemetry gateway drops below 80% ingest for more than ten minutes, restart the collector service first. If ingest does not recover, check the broker queue depth and note it in the incident log. Anything beyond a single restart must be escalated; contractors should not modify gateway config. Send escalations to the gateway on-call inbox.

billing contact of hahig-yajop = fraael_fraox@nelvrocorp.internal

Subject: Tilecache cut-over complete

The map-tile prefetcher (Quarrow) is now live on the new Fenwick cluster as of last night. Old hosts are drained and will be decommissioned Friday. Prefetch hit rates look consistent with staging, and no alerting changes were needed. For future reference, the service runs with the following configuration values, which should be kept in sync with the deploy repo.

service settings:
[oliix]
team = noveth
access_code = ac_4de949
host = oliix.novachq.corp
port = 8080
owner = wenir.casion
peer = wenys.lumicstack.corp

Fire drills at Larchmont House happen roughly once a quarter, and reception runs the roll call. Grab the red clipboard, head to the Birch Court muster point, and tick people off against the morning sign-in sheet. Afterwards, you'll re-arm the lobby doors before anyone comes back in. To reset the door panel, enter the code below.

staff pass of kawip-hawef = bdg-QLP-2